Model1.msl 9.8 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173
  1. <?xml version="1.0" encoding="utf-8"?>
  2. <Mapping Space="C-S" xmlns="http://schemas.microsoft.com/ado/2009/11/mapping/cs">
  3. <EntityContainerMapping StorageEntityContainer="Хранилище KadroviYshotModelContainer" CdmEntityContainer="KadroviYshotEntities">
  4. <EntitySetMapping Name="Childrens">
  5. <EntityTypeMapping TypeName="KadroviYshotModel.Childrens">
  6. <MappingFragment StoreEntitySet="Childrens">
  7. <ScalarProperty Name="IdChildren" ColumnName="IdChildren" />
  8. <ScalarProperty Name="IdEmployee" ColumnName="IdEmployee" />
  9. <ScalarProperty Name="Type" ColumnName="Type" />
  10. <ScalarProperty Name="FullName" ColumnName="FullName" />
  11. <ScalarProperty Name="DateBirth" ColumnName="DateBirth" />
  12. </MappingFragment>
  13. </EntityTypeMapping>
  14. </EntitySetMapping>
  15. <EntitySetMapping Name="Dolzhnosts">
  16. <EntityTypeMapping TypeName="KadroviYshotModel.Dolzhnosts">
  17. <MappingFragment StoreEntitySet="Dolzhnosts">
  18. <ScalarProperty Name="IdDolzhnost" ColumnName="IdDolzhnost" />
  19. <ScalarProperty Name="NameDolzhnost" ColumnName="NameDolzhnost" />
  20. <ScalarProperty Name="Salary" ColumnName="Salary" />
  21. </MappingFragment>
  22. </EntityTypeMapping>
  23. </EntitySetMapping>
  24. <EntitySetMapping Name="Educations">
  25. <EntityTypeMapping TypeName="KadroviYshotModel.Educations">
  26. <MappingFragment StoreEntitySet="Educations">
  27. <ScalarProperty Name="IdEducation" ColumnName="IdEducation" />
  28. <ScalarProperty Name="Establishment" ColumnName="Establishment" />
  29. <ScalarProperty Name="YearEnding" ColumnName="YearEnding" />
  30. <ScalarProperty Name="Qualification" ColumnName="Qualification" />
  31. <ScalarProperty Name="Speciality" ColumnName="Speciality" />
  32. </MappingFragment>
  33. </EntityTypeMapping>
  34. </EntitySetMapping>
  35. <EntitySetMapping Name="Employees">
  36. <EntityTypeMapping TypeName="KadroviYshotModel.Employees">
  37. <MappingFragment StoreEntitySet="Employees">
  38. <ScalarProperty Name="IdEmployee" ColumnName="IdEmployee" />
  39. <ScalarProperty Name="Surname" ColumnName="Surname" />
  40. <ScalarProperty Name="Name" ColumnName="Name" />
  41. <ScalarProperty Name="Otchestvo" ColumnName="Otchestvo" />
  42. <ScalarProperty Name="DateBirth" ColumnName="DateBirth" />
  43. <ScalarProperty Name="IdDolzhnost" ColumnName="IdDolzhnost" />
  44. <ScalarProperty Name="IdFamilyStatus" ColumnName="IdFamilyStatus" />
  45. <ScalarProperty Name="AddressResidence" ColumnName="AddressResidence" />
  46. <ScalarProperty Name="Telephone" ColumnName="Telephone" />
  47. <ScalarProperty Name="DateReceipt" ColumnName="DateReceipt" />
  48. <ScalarProperty Name="IdEducation" ColumnName="IdEducation" />
  49. <ScalarProperty Name="IdChildren" ColumnName="IdChildren" />
  50. <ScalarProperty Name="IdMilitaryDuty" ColumnName="IdMilitaryDuty" />
  51. </MappingFragment>
  52. </EntityTypeMapping>
  53. </EntitySetMapping>
  54. <EntitySetMapping Name="FamilyStatuses">
  55. <EntityTypeMapping TypeName="KadroviYshotModel.FamilyStatuses">
  56. <MappingFragment StoreEntitySet="FamilyStatuses">
  57. <ScalarProperty Name="IdFamilyStatus" ColumnName="IdFamilyStatus" />
  58. <ScalarProperty Name="Name" ColumnName="Name" />
  59. </MappingFragment>
  60. </EntityTypeMapping>
  61. </EntitySetMapping>
  62. <EntitySetMapping Name="MilitaryDuties">
  63. <EntityTypeMapping TypeName="KadroviYshotModel.MilitaryDuties">
  64. <MappingFragment StoreEntitySet="MilitaryDuties">
  65. <ScalarProperty Name="IdMilitaryDuty" ColumnName="IdMilitaryDuty" />
  66. <ScalarProperty Name="MilitaryIdNumber" ColumnName="MilitaryIdNumber" />
  67. <ScalarProperty Name="AccountingGroup" ColumnName="AccountingGroup" />
  68. <ScalarProperty Name="MilitaryRank" ColumnName="MilitaryRank" />
  69. <ScalarProperty Name="Profile" ColumnName="Profile" />
  70. <ScalarProperty Name="ReserveRank" ColumnName="ReserveRank" />
  71. <ScalarProperty Name="DateReceipt" ColumnName="DateReceipt" />
  72. <ScalarProperty Name="DateWithdrawal" ColumnName="DateWithdrawal" />
  73. <ScalarProperty Name="Base" ColumnName="Base" />
  74. <ScalarProperty Name="SpecialAccount" ColumnName="SpecialAccount" />
  75. <ScalarProperty Name="MilitaryRegistrationNumber" ColumnName="MilitaryRegistrationNumber" />
  76. <ScalarProperty Name="MilitaryPositionCode" ColumnName="MilitaryPositionCode" />
  77. </MappingFragment>
  78. </EntityTypeMapping>
  79. </EntitySetMapping>
  80. <EntitySetMapping Name="OrdersDismissal">
  81. <EntityTypeMapping TypeName="KadroviYshotModel.OrdersDismissal">
  82. <MappingFragment StoreEntitySet="OrdersDismissal">
  83. <ScalarProperty Name="IdDismissal" ColumnName="IdDismissal" />
  84. <ScalarProperty Name="IdEmployee" ColumnName="IdEmployee" />
  85. <ScalarProperty Name="DateApproval" ColumnName="DateApproval" />
  86. <ScalarProperty Name="Grounds" ColumnName="Grounds" />
  87. </MappingFragment>
  88. </EntityTypeMapping>
  89. </EntitySetMapping>
  90. <EntitySetMapping Name="OrdersEmployment">
  91. <EntityTypeMapping TypeName="KadroviYshotModel.OrdersEmployment">
  92. <MappingFragment StoreEntitySet="OrdersEmployment">
  93. <ScalarProperty Name="IdAcceptanceWork" ColumnName="IdAcceptanceWork" />
  94. <ScalarProperty Name="IdEmployee" ColumnName="IdEmployee" />
  95. <ScalarProperty Name="IdStaffingTable" ColumnName="IdStaffingTable" />
  96. <ScalarProperty Name="IdDolzhnost" ColumnName="IdDolzhnost" />
  97. <ScalarProperty Name="DateApproval" ColumnName="DateApproval" />
  98. </MappingFragment>
  99. </EntityTypeMapping>
  100. </EntitySetMapping>
  101. <EntitySetMapping Name="Roles">
  102. <EntityTypeMapping TypeName="KadroviYshotModel.Roles">
  103. <MappingFragment StoreEntitySet="Roles">
  104. <ScalarProperty Name="IdRole" ColumnName="IdRole" />
  105. <ScalarProperty Name="Name" ColumnName="Name" />
  106. </MappingFragment>
  107. </EntityTypeMapping>
  108. </EntitySetMapping>
  109. <EntitySetMapping Name="StaffingTables">
  110. <EntityTypeMapping TypeName="KadroviYshotModel.StaffingTables">
  111. <MappingFragment StoreEntitySet="StaffingTables">
  112. <ScalarProperty Name="IdStaffingTable" ColumnName="IdStaffingTable" />
  113. <ScalarProperty Name="IdEmployee" ColumnName="IdEmployee" />
  114. <ScalarProperty Name="IdSubdivision" ColumnName="IdSubdivision" />
  115. </MappingFragment>
  116. </EntityTypeMapping>
  117. </EntitySetMapping>
  118. <EntitySetMapping Name="Subdivisions">
  119. <EntityTypeMapping TypeName="KadroviYshotModel.Subdivisions">
  120. <MappingFragment StoreEntitySet="Subdivisions">
  121. <ScalarProperty Name="IdSubdivision" ColumnName="IdSubdivision" />
  122. <ScalarProperty Name="NameSubdivision" ColumnName="NameSubdivision" />
  123. </MappingFragment>
  124. </EntityTypeMapping>
  125. </EntitySetMapping>
  126. <EntitySetMapping Name="sysdiagrams">
  127. <EntityTypeMapping TypeName="KadroviYshotModel.sysdiagrams">
  128. <MappingFragment StoreEntitySet="sysdiagrams">
  129. <ScalarProperty Name="name" ColumnName="name" />
  130. <ScalarProperty Name="principal_id" ColumnName="principal_id" />
  131. <ScalarProperty Name="diagram_id" ColumnName="diagram_id" />
  132. <ScalarProperty Name="version" ColumnName="version" />
  133. <ScalarProperty Name="definition" ColumnName="definition" />
  134. </MappingFragment>
  135. </EntityTypeMapping>
  136. </EntitySetMapping>
  137. <EntitySetMapping Name="Users">
  138. <EntityTypeMapping TypeName="KadroviYshotModel.Users">
  139. <MappingFragment StoreEntitySet="Users">
  140. <ScalarProperty Name="IdUser" ColumnName="IdUser" />
  141. <ScalarProperty Name="Name" ColumnName="Name" />
  142. <ScalarProperty Name="Login" ColumnName="Login" />
  143. <ScalarProperty Name="Password" ColumnName="Password" />
  144. <ScalarProperty Name="IdRole" ColumnName="IdRole" />
  145. </MappingFragment>
  146. </EntityTypeMapping>
  147. </EntitySetMapping>
  148. <FunctionImportMapping FunctionImportName="sp_alterdiagram" FunctionName="Хранилище KadroviYshotModel.sp_alterdiagram" />
  149. <FunctionImportMapping FunctionImportName="sp_creatediagram" FunctionName="Хранилище KadroviYshotModel.sp_creatediagram" />
  150. <FunctionImportMapping FunctionImportName="sp_dropdiagram" FunctionName="Хранилище KadroviYshotModel.sp_dropdiagram" />
  151. <FunctionImportMapping FunctionImportName="sp_helpdiagramdefinition" FunctionName="Хранилище KadroviYshotModel.sp_helpdiagramdefinition">
  152. <ResultMapping>
  153. <ComplexTypeMapping TypeName="KadroviYshotModel.sp_helpdiagramdefinition_Result">
  154. <ScalarProperty Name="version" ColumnName="version" />
  155. <ScalarProperty Name="definition" ColumnName="definition" />
  156. </ComplexTypeMapping>
  157. </ResultMapping>
  158. </FunctionImportMapping>
  159. <FunctionImportMapping FunctionImportName="sp_helpdiagrams" FunctionName="Хранилище KadroviYshotModel.sp_helpdiagrams">
  160. <ResultMapping>
  161. <ComplexTypeMapping TypeName="KadroviYshotModel.sp_helpdiagrams_Result">
  162. <ScalarProperty Name="Database" ColumnName="Database" />
  163. <ScalarProperty Name="Name" ColumnName="Name" />
  164. <ScalarProperty Name="ID" ColumnName="ID" />
  165. <ScalarProperty Name="Owner" ColumnName="Owner" />
  166. <ScalarProperty Name="OwnerID" ColumnName="OwnerID" />
  167. </ComplexTypeMapping>
  168. </ResultMapping>
  169. </FunctionImportMapping>
  170. <FunctionImportMapping FunctionImportName="sp_renamediagram" FunctionName="Хранилище KadroviYshotModel.sp_renamediagram" />
  171. <FunctionImportMapping FunctionImportName="sp_upgraddiagrams" FunctionName="Хранилище KadroviYshotModel.sp_upgraddiagrams" />
  172. </EntityContainerMapping>
  173. </Mapping>